Starts the checking with :meth:`linkcheck.director.check_urls`, passing the *aggregate*. Finally it counts any errors and exits with the appropriate code. .. rubric:: Checking & Parsing That is: - Checking a link is valid - Parsing the document the link points to for new links :meth:`linkcheck.director.check_urls` authenticates with a login form if one is configured via :meth:`linkcheck.director.aggregator.Aggregate.visit_loginurl`, starts logging with :meth:`linkcheck.director.aggregator.Aggregate.logger.start_log_output` and calls :meth:`linkcheck.director.aggregator.Aggregate.start_threads` which instantiates a :class:`linkcheck.director.checker.Checker` object with the urlqueue if there is at least one thread configured, else it calls :meth:`linkcheck.director.checker.check_urls` which loops through the entries in the *urlqueue*. Either way :meth:`linkcheck.director.checker.check_url` tests to see if *url_data* already has a result and whether the cache already has a result for that key. If not it calls *url_data.check()*, which calls *url_data.check_content()* that runs content plugins and returns *do_parse* according to *url_data.do_check_content* and :meth:`linkcheck.checker.urlbase.UrlBase.allows_recursion` which includes :meth:`linkcheck.checker.urlbase.UrlBase.allows_simple_recursion` that is monitoring the recursion level (with :attr:`linkcheck.checker.urlbase.UrlBase.recursion_level`). If *do_parse* is True, passes the *url_data* object to :meth:`linkcheck.parser.parse_url` to call a `linkcheck.parser.parse_` method according to the document type e.g. :meth:`linkcheck.parser.parse_html` for HTML which calls :meth:`linkcheck.htmlutil.linkparse.find_links` passing *url_data.get_soup()* and *url_data.add_url*. `url_data.add_url` puts the new *url_data* object on the *urlqueue*.
